qeth
Albanian
Etymology
From Proto-Albanian *kaiδ-, from Proto-Indo-European *kh₂eyd-. Cognate to Latin caedo (“to cut, hew, lop, fell”)[1].
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/c͡çɛθ/
Verb
qeth (first-person singular past tense qetha, participle qethur)
- I cut (hair, wool etc.)
